Output 3f000b59539751981bb64cb2ec4274316b3acbeefc59688f86fc7e53e0782b91:1

value
148636080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4a8188bf42df45d5a30a9613c70ae8e64c02c2e OP_EQUAL
address
3PzeArg4zPwi7nbjKFvndW3Efgjt8XHbZk
transaction
3f000b59539751981bb64cb2ec4274316b3acbeefc59688f86fc7e53e0782b91
confirmations
489457
spent
true